The primary narrative follows 20-Squad as they respond to a violent home invasion at the residence of Hollywood actress . The case takes a personal turn when the team is forced to collaborate with Rodrigo Sanchez , a former 20-Squad leader and long-time nemesis of Hondo. Sanchez, now working private security for the studio, finds himself back in Hondo’s orbit, creating a friction-filled environment where professional necessity clashes with past betrayals. The seventh episode of S.W.A.T. Season 6, titled explores the complex intersection of high-stakes celebrity culture and the lingering shadows of past rivalries. Aired on December 2, 2022, the episode functions as both a tense tactical procedural and a character study on professional maturity and personal transition.
